DHCP-сервер: опис, установка, включення, авторизація та налаштування

Хост-машина під управлінням Linux

Dhcp-сервер Linux корисний для мережі, якщо користувач не хоче складнощів призначення статичних IP-адрес. Якщо є домашній маршрутизатор, наприклад, D-Link або будь бездротовий модем. Такі пристрої будуть мати DHCP-сервер, вбудований для видачі внутрішніх IP-адрес. Тим не менш, вони рідко підходять для ділових цілей по безлічі причин.

Однією з головних є проблема, у зв’язку з тим, що ними зазвичай не надаються досить параметрів конфігурації, щоб змусити сервер працювати з користувацької інфраструктурою, що має декількох десятків хостів. Виділений сервер, працюючий на хост-комп’ютері Linux, може бути хорошою альтернативою, безкоштовною і простий в налаштуванні.

Установка Linux DHCP:

  • RHEL / CentOS: yum install dhcp -y.
  • Ubuntu раніше 12.04 або Debian старше Wheezy (7.0): sudo apt-get install dhcp3-server.
  • Ubuntu 12.04 і більш пізні версії або Debian Wheezy, а потім: sudo apt-get install isc-dhcp-server. Щоб запустити сервер і налаштувати його на автозапуск при завантаженні.
  • Вибрати команду на основі версії DHCP.
  • Налаштування dhcp сервера ISC-DHCP:

  • Запуск служби isc-dhcp-server chkconfig isc-dhcp-server on dhcp3.
  • Запуск служби dhcp3-server chkconfig dhcp3-server on DHCPD (CentOS / RHEL).
  • Запуск служби dhcpd chkconfig dhcpd.